Zomig is a prescription medicine approved to treat migraine headaches in adults. Only your doctor can determine if Zomig is right for you. Zomig is not for the prevention of migraines or for the treatment of hemiplegic or basilar migraines. Zomig is not for other types of headaches.

In 4 clinical studies, adult patients with moderate or severe migraine headaches were treated with Zomig Tablets 5 mg or a placebo (sugar pill). The headache response referred to in the study results below is defined as the percentage of patients with moderate or severe headache who improved to mild headache or no pain 2 hours after treatment.
- In Study 1, 245 patients were treated with Zomig 5 mg and 121 patients were treated with placebo. Headache response was found in 67% of patients on Zomig 5 mg and 34% of patients on placebo
- In Study 2, 179 patients were treated with Zomig 5 mg and 88 patients were treated with placebo. Headache response was found in 66% of patients on Zomig 5 mg and 19% of patients on placebo
- In Study 3, 491 patients were treated with Zomig 5 mg and 55 patients were treated with placebo. Headache response was found in 59% of patients on Zomig 5 mg and 44% of patients on placebo
- In Study 4, 20 patients were treated with Zomig 5 mg and 19 patients were treated with placebo. Headache response was found in 60% of patients on Zomig 5 mg and 16% of patients on placebo
In the only study that directly compared Zomig Tablets 2.5 mg and Zomig Tablets 5 mg, there was little added benefit from the larger 5-mg dose, but side effects were generally increased at 5 mg. Patients should, therefore, be started on a dose of 2.5 mg or lower. A dose of lower than 2.5 mg can be achieved by manually breaking the scored 2.5 mg Tablet in half.
